Senior Financial Analyst - Permanent Full-Time



Position Summary:



The Senior Financial Analyst is a highly motivated self-starter who seeks to understand all aspects of current Hospital capital, financial and statistical reporting. The position provides support in meeting our financial information requirements of both internal and external customers, including budgeting and planning, reporting, financial analysis and statistics and our capital.

Primary Responsibilities:



Provides complex, value-added financial analysis and evaluate financial services in a timely and accurate manner, applying financial insight to developing plans, close gaps or identity alternative action and make recommendations Develops Monthly/Quarterly and Annual financial variance and performance analysis Developing initial project budgets and detailed financial models Managing project financials, tracking funding allocations, and preparing financial reports for internal and external stakeholders/funders Ensuring project plans align with Ministry of Health or other governmental capital planning policies and standards Assist with audits, including coordination/preparation of audit working papers and related notes to the financial statements

The successful candidate will possess the following qualifications/experience:



Undergraduate degree in Accounting, Business Administration or a related field Chartered Professional Accounting designation required Minimum 3 years of experience in financial analysis and budgeting experience in health care environment Demonstrated leadership potential Solid understanding and working knowledge of PSAS and regulations/legislation related to areas of functional responsibility Strong people/project leadership skills and ability to collaborate with various stakeholders, including Senior Leadership, clinical and enabling services leadership, and other external partners such as the Ministry of Health, Infrastructure Ontario and the External Auditor of the organization Highly effective interpersonal and communication skills combined with critical thinking and customer-focused mindset Strategic conceptual thinker with the ability to integrate "big picture" thinking into operations Computer skills, including M365 Office, Word, Excel (advanced), Budman and Meditech Excellent analytical and organizational skills with attention to detail
